Azimuth Capital Management

Investor type

VC

Founded

2000

AUM

$1 600 M

Location

Canada

$10-50 m

Investment Ticket

3-5 years

Investment Horizon

Seed, Series B

Investment Stage

Sale to strategic investor, IPO

Exit Strategy

Investor profile last updated: 06 December, 2025

Profile

Azimuth Capital Management is an experienced, leading North American energy-focused private equity fund manager with $1.6 billion of cumulative assets under management and an additional $1.8 billion of co-investment capital under management. Since inception, Azimuth has pursued a complimentary dual strategy: thoughtfully assembling a unique portfolio of Differentiated Energy Resource businesses together with a portfolio of Energy Evolution opportunities characterized as growth stage energy companies with proven technology advantages and affirmative environmental impact.

Industry

Industrial Real Estate Utilities

Region of investment

North America Europe

Contacts

Upgrade to see contacts
Name
Title
Email
avatar
2oneMsQVCabgqDwK 2oneMsQVCabgqDwK
2oneMsQVCabgqDwK
avatar
2oneMsQVCabgqDwK 2oneMsQVCabgqDwK
2oneMsQVCabgqDwK
avatar
2oneMsQVCabgqDwK 2oneMsQVCabgqDwK
2oneMsQVCabgqDwK
avatar
2oneMsQVCabgqDwK 2oneMsQVCabgqDwK
2oneMsQVCabgqDwK
avatar
2oneMsQVCabgqDwK 2oneMsQVCabgqDwK
2oneMsQVCabgqDwK
If there are no contacts of this investor, please write to us, we will try to find them as soon as possible and get back to you!

FAQs about Azimuth Capital Management

Azimuth Capital Management is located in Canada.
Azimuth Capital Management was founded in 2000.
Azimuth Capital Management invests in companies and startups in Industrial, Real Estate, Utilities.
Azimuth Capital Management invests in companies and startups in North America, Europe.
Azimuth Capital Management invests in companies and startups at Seed, Series B.
Azimuth Capital Management usually invests $10-50 m on average.
Azimuth Capital Management has around $1 600m assets under management.